Family Falconidae is a group of birds of prey that encompasses about 70 species worldwide. However, there are a few alternative names that refer to this family. One commonly used name is the Falcon family. Another synonym is "Falconiformes", which is a higher taxonomic rank that also includes other families of diurnal raptors. Falcons are known for their powerful wings and sharp talons, which make them top predators in their environment. They are distributed across many habitats, from deserts to forests, and are still widely used in falconry. Overall, Family Falconidae is a fascinating group of birds that inspires awe and admiration among birdwatchers and nature lovers.
